These notebooks provide examples of one method for processing timeseries data from the COMPASS system described in Brown et al (2016)
How to cite: Brown LA, Hasan S, Foster RG and Peirson SN. COMPASS: Continuous Open Mouse Phenotyping of Activity and Sleep Status [version 2; referees: 4 approved]. Wellcome Open Res 2017, 1:2 (doi: 10.12688/wellcomeopenres.9892.2)
now including notebook for revised manuscript (v2) with one method for analysis of bouts of sleep
The analysis uses the Python programming language, version 2.7.11, as well a a number of more specific packages. These are all found as part of the Anaconda Python environment produced by Contiuum Analytics This is BSD licenced and cross platform. (https://www.continuum.io/downloads)
all required python packages:
- pandas 0.18.0
- numpy 1.10.4
- matplotlib 1.5.1
- seaborn 0.7.0
(environment can be recreated using 'conda create included COMPASS.yml file)
conda env create -f COMPASS.yml
